Biographical entry Steel, William Howard (Beattie) (1920 - 2004)
- Born
- 1920
- Died
- 2004
- Occupation
- Physicist
- Alternative Names
- Steel, Beattie (Also known as)
Summary
Beattie Steel worked on optical munitions design for the Optical Munitions Panel and became an international expert in interferometry. Beattie Steel was the first chairman of the Australian Optical Society and served as president of the International Commission for Optics.
Details
Events
- 1940s
- Career position - Australasian Wireless Association
- 1940
- Education - Mathematics and Physics studies at the University of Melbourne
- c. 1945 - 1985
- Career position - Joined the CSIRO (Commonwealth Scientific and Industrial Research Organisation) National Standards Laboratory
- 1953
- Education - Awarded Physics Doctorate from Sorbonne University, Paris France
- 1972 - 1975
- Career position - President of the International Commission for Optics
- 1983
- Chair - First chairperson of the Australian Optical Society
- 1985
- Award - Received the Mees Medal of the Optical Society of America
- 1986 -
- Career position - Honorary Professorial Fellow at Macquarie University
- 2004
- Award (posthumous) - Highest Award from the Australian Optical Society renamed 'The Australian Optical Society W. H. (Beattie) Steel Medal'.
